Historical Significance
Haiti's history is marked by significant events that have shaped not only the nation but also the world. One of the most notable Amazing Facts About Haiti is its role in the Haitian Revolution, which began in 1791. This revolution was a pivotal moment in history, as it was the only successful slave rebellion that led to the establishment of a free black republic. The revolution not only abolished slavery but also inspired similar movements in other parts of the world.
Another key historical event is Haiti's declaration of independence on January 1, 1804. This marked the end of French colonial rule and the beginning of Haiti as an independent nation. The declaration was a bold statement against colonialism and slavery, making Haiti the first black republic in the world. This event is celebrated annually as Haiti's Independence Day, a day of national pride and unity.
Cultural Heritage
Haiti's cultural heritage is a vibrant blend of African, French, and indigenous influences. This unique mix is evident in various aspects of Haitian life, from music and dance to art and cuisine. One of the most distinctive Amazing Facts About Haiti is its music, which includes genres like compas, rara, and twoubadou. These musical styles are not only entertaining but also deeply rooted in the country's history and traditions.
Haitian art is another area where the country shines. Haitian art is known for its bold colors, intricate designs, and often spiritual themes. Artists like Hector Hyppolite and Philome Obin have gained international recognition for their unique styles and contributions to the art world. The art reflects the country's rich cultural heritage and the resilience of its people.
Haitian cuisine is a delightful fusion of flavors and ingredients. Dishes like griot (fried pork), diri ak pwa (rice and beans), and soup joumou (pumpkin soup) are staples in Haitian households. These dishes are not only delicious but also tell a story of the country's history and cultural influences. The soup joumou, in particular, is a symbol of Haitian independence and is traditionally served on January 1st to commemorate the country's independence.
Natural Wonders
Haiti is home to a variety of natural wonders that attract visitors from around the world. The country's diverse landscape includes lush mountains, pristine beaches, and dense forests. One of the most stunning natural sites is the Pic la Selle, the highest point in Haiti. Standing at 2,680 meters, it offers breathtaking views of the surrounding landscape and is a popular destination for hikers and nature enthusiasts.
Another natural wonder is the Citadelle Laferrière, a massive fortress built in the early 19th century. This UNESCO World Heritage Site is a testament to Haiti's resilience and ingenuity. The fortress was constructed to protect the newly independent nation from French invasions and is a symbol of Haiti's struggle for freedom. Visitors can explore the fortress and learn about its history through guided tours.
Haiti's beaches are also a major attraction. With over 1,700 kilometers of coastline, the country boasts some of the most beautiful beaches in the Caribbean. Places like Labadee and Île-à-Vache offer crystal-clear waters, white sand beaches, and a variety of water sports. These beaches are perfect for relaxation and adventure, making them popular destinations for both locals and tourists.

Cultural Festivals and Events
Haiti is known for its vibrant cultural festivals and events, which celebrate the country's rich heritage and traditions. These festivals offer a unique opportunity to experience Haitian culture firsthand and participate in various activities and performances. One of the most popular festivals is the Carnival of Haiti, held annually in February. The carnival features colorful parades, traditional music, and dance performances, making it a lively and festive event.
Another notable event is the Gede Festival, held in November. This festival honors the spirits of the dead and is a time for reflection and remembrance. The festival includes traditional rituals, music, and dance performances, providing a glimpse into Haiti's spiritual beliefs and practices.
